首页 | 本学科首页   官方微博 | 高级检索  
     检索      

一种启发式A*算法和网格划分的空间可达性计算方法
引用本文:马林兵,曹小曙.一种启发式A*算法和网格划分的空间可达性计算方法[J].地理研究,2008,27(1):93-99.
作者姓名:马林兵  曹小曙
作者单位:中山大学地理科学与规划学院,广州,510275
基金项目:国家自然科学基金项目(40571052);“985工程”GIS与遥感的地学应用科技创新平台资助项目(105203200400006);教育部地理信息系统重点实验室〈武汉大学〉开放基金(wd200604)
摘    要:本文提出了一个适用于研究城市内部的个体或商业区位的微观可达性计算方法,该方法的核心是将研究区域进行等距的网格划分,通过计算每个网格的可达性指标,来研究整个区域的可达性的空间分布特点。在可达性计算中,利用网格内的道路密度和土地利用状态这两个因素来模拟计算每个网格的交通成本,引入了启发式A *空间搜索算法来计算网格间路径的交通成本,并且加入适当的启发信息,提高了搜索效率,使搜索结果更符合实际需求。最后,基于本文提出的方法,利用GIS二次开发工具ArcEngine开发了计算程序,收集了多源数据,以广州市商务区的可达性作为计算对象,进行了商务区的可达性和易达性案例计算。

关 键 词:可达性  启发式A  *算法  城市交通
文章编号:1000-0585(2008)01-0093-07
收稿时间:8/9/2007 12:00:00 AM
修稿时间:2007-11-24

A computing method of spatial accessibility based on heuristic A* algorithms and grids partition
MA Lin-bing,CAO Xiao-shu.A computing method of spatial accessibility based on heuristic A* algorithms and grids partition[J].Geographical Research,2008,27(1):93-99.
Authors:MA Lin-bing  CAO Xiao-shu
Institution:School of Geography and Planning, Sun Yat-sen University, Guangzhou 510257, China
Abstract:An accessibility computing method based on grid partition and heuristic A * searching algorithms was put forward in the paper, which is used to research accessibility spatial distribution feature in the study area through computing each grid's accessibility. Traffic cost is an important element in accessibility computing. There are two approaches to stimulate grid traffic cost, one is approach of density of road network, and the other one is approach of relative spatial resistance for different land use status. The density of road network is anti-correlative with traffic cost. Land use has a close relationship with urban traffic, so grid relative traffic cost can be stimulated directly by integrating the two approaches, actual status of road and topological structure of road network was ignored. A computing formula of grid relative traffic cost was defined in the paper. The key point is how to compute traffic cost of grids path. Dijkstra algorithm makes sure to get the lowest traffic cost, but it must spend more searching space and time. Not only can A * algorithms improve searching efficiency, but also can add some heuristic searching information to make searching result more reasonable. The key of the searching process is the definition of heuristic evaluation function H, which is responsible for estimating traffic cost from intermediate grid to target grid. Usually, marching from one spot to another is constrained by two factors: distance and arrival angle. So Euclid distance and marching arrival angle are adopted to evaluate traffic cost. In application, in order to make computing result accorded with practice, more heuristic information can be imported into computing process. For verifying our research, a software package was developed with C# language under ArcEngine9 environment. A case study was implemented by using the package. Accessibility of business districts was selected as computing object in Guangzhou city. The computing result by using the method can provide a quantitative reference for urban planning of the city.
Keywords:accessibility  heuristic A* algorithms  urban traffic
本文献已被 维普 万方数据 等数据库收录!
点击此处可从《地理研究》浏览原始摘要信息
点击此处可从《地理研究》下载免费的PDF全文
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号